草庐IT

OpenStack$Kubernetes

全部标签

Kubernetes(k8s) 1.24.0版本基于Containerd的集群安装部署

目录1.部署方式2.集群规划3.containerd安装4.安装k8s集群4.1基础环境4.2安装kubelet、kubeadm、kubectl4.3下载各个机器需要的镜像4.4初始化主节点(只在master节点执行)4.5设置.kube/config(只在master执行)4.6安装网络插件calico(只在master执行)4.7加入node节点(只在node执行)4.7.1node节点可以执行kubectl命令方法5.部署dashboard(只在master执行)5.1部署5.2设置访问端口5.3创建访问账号5.4获取访问令牌6.安装nginx进行测试7.其它可选模块部署7.1metri

【云原生 • Kubernetes】一文深入理解资源编排 - yaml 文件

本文导读1.yaml文件概述2.yaml文件书写格式3.yaml文件组成部分及字段含义4.如何快速编写yaml文件•方法一:kubectlcreate生成•方法二:kubectlget导出1.yaml文件概述Kubernetes集群中对资源管理和资源对象的编排部署可以通过声明样式(yaml)文件的方式来解决,把需要对资源对象的操作都编辑到yaml格式的文件中,这种文件叫做资源清单文件。通过kubectl命令可以直接使用资源清单文件实现对大量的资源对象进行编排和部署。2.yaml文件书写格式yaml的可读性非常高,它是用来表达数据序列的格式。它本身仍是一种标记语言,但这种语言是以数据为中心,而不

第二篇:kubernetes部署calico网络插件

说明:总的目标是在k8s集群部署gitlab、jenkins,并且在本地提交代码到gitlab后jenkin流水线可以自动编译打包成为docker镜像然后部署到k8s中并实现客户端外部域名访问,在文档分为多个部分,其中涉及的技术有docker安装、k8s搭建、部署gitlab、部署jenkins、部署sonarqube、gitlab和jenkin联动、jenkins和sonarqube联动、pipline脚本编写、istio部署、istio服务网关等…此文档接第一篇:kubernetes部署实操这篇文档讲解的是kubernetns部署calico网络插件文章目录1.下载calico的yaml文

基于Docker的K8s(Kubernetes)集群部署

开始搭建k8s集群三台服务器修改主机名称hostnamectlset-hostnamemasterhostnamectlset-hostnamenode1hostnamectlset-hostnamenode2关闭对话窗口,重新连接三台主机名称呢就修改成功了。接下来修改每台节点的hosts文件vim/etc/hostsxxx.xxx.xxx.xxxmasterxxx.xxx.xxx.xxxnode1xxx.xxx.xxx.xxxnode2所有节点关闭setLinuxsetenforce0sed-i--follow-symlinks's/SELINUX=enforcing/SELINUX=dis

kubernetes+KubeEdge云边环境的安装与部署

最近在学习云边协同,需要搭建一个云边协同的实验环境,kubernetes+KubeEdge+sedna,安装过程中遇到了一系列的问题,特此记录总结。kubernetes的安装与部署:实验环境云端:Centos7+kubernetes1.23.8+Docker这里我们的centos使用的是centos7.9,不同版本的系统对k8s影响较大,具体看实际情况而定。有的还需要更新系统内核。部署教程前置需求了解image、container、pod等概念基础指令:容器运行时工具基本用法能耐心读容器日志能耐心读大量文档部署k8s环境,但k8s本身是一个相当前沿的项目而且架构仍然在改变,所以网上的教程会有很

CL210管理OPENSTACK网络--开放虚拟网络(OVN)简介

🎹个人简介:大家好,我是金鱼哥,CSDN运维领域新星创作者,华为云·云享专家,阿里云社区·专家博主📚个人资质:CCNA、HCNP、CSNA(网络分析师),软考初级、中级网络工程师、RHCSA、RHCE、RHCA、RHCI、ITIL😜💬格言:努力不一定成功,但要想成功就必须努力🔥🎈支持我:可点赞👍、可收藏⭐️、可留言📝文章目录📜模块化层2(ML2)简介📑ML2驱动程序和网络类型📜开放虚拟网络(OVN)简介📑OVN架构📑OVN数据库📑OVN和OpenFlow📑OVN逻辑流📜比较ML2/OVS两个ML2/OVN📑关键的不同点📜OVN网关路由器📑OVN有三种NAT:📜安全组介绍📑实现安全组📑Connt

国基北盛 openstack 云平台搭建保姆级步骤

需要使用到的软件VMware-workstation-full-16.1.2链接:https://pan.baidu.com/s/1oauUyyfQFNAKboUXDu9QQg?pwd=6666提取码:6666SecureCRTPortable链接:https://pan.baidu.com/s/1kXJsYeQuQeClJYNbgkIjRw?pwd=6666提取码:6666需要下载以下三种镜像CentOS-7.5-x86_64-DVD-1804链接:https://pan.baidu.com/s/1xy8PIGowJZeFQjCGO8mtCA?pwd=6666提取码:6666CentOS-7

openstack编排heat(云主机类型,云主机,网络)

在自行搭建的OpenStack平台上,编写heat模板createnet.yml,模板作用为创建网络。  排错中,希望大佬可以指正以下错误ERROR:Propertyerror::resources.subnet.properties::Valuemustbeastring;got[{u'get_resources':u'network'}]下面是配置vimserver.ymlheat_template_version:2013-05-23description:TestTemplateresources: network:  type:OS::Neutron::Net  properties

Kubernetes(k8s)PV、PVC

目录一、PV和PVC1、PV概念2、PVC概念3、PV与PVC3.1、PV与PVC之间的关系3.2、PV和PVC的生命周期3.3、一个PV从创建到销毁的具体流程3.4、三种回收策略3.5、查看pv、pvc的定义方式、规格4、PV的提供方式二、基于NFS创建静态PV、PVC2.1、NFS服务部署 2.2、创建PV2.3、定义PVC2.4、多路读写测试三、基于动态storageclass创建PV、PVC3.1、storageclass定义 3.2、storageclass用途3.3、基于NFS动态创建PV、PVC3.4、测试容器磁盘上的文件的生命周期是短暂的,这就使得在容器中运行重要应用时会出现一

云计算平台OPENSTACK-IAAS服务搭建-双节点【详解】

目录:导读OPENSTACK云平台基础架构步骤1.搭建虚拟机:2.IAAS搭建流程第一步基础搭建:OPENSTACK云平台基础架构本来要搭建4节点,控制节点,网路节点,计算节点,存储节点,但是。。。。。此次搭建使用双节点测试,更多集群部署请自行增加即可。步骤openstack云平台基础架构1.搭建虚拟机:2.IAAS搭建流程Controller搭建Compute:(2核,8G)组件部署controllercompute1.搭建虚拟机:Controller控制节点–网络节点要求:内存4G+,2核+,双网卡(NET模式,仅主机模式),虚拟化引擎打开,硬盘一个大小看需求,镜像centos7。Comp